Bit 0 - Change in Loop-back Request Interrupt
Status, M23 # 1.
This âReset-upon-Readâ bit-field indicates whether or
not there has been a change in the âLoop-back Re-
quest Statusâ for DS2 Channel # 1.
This bit-field will be set to â0â if there has been no
change in the âLoop-back Request Statusâ for DS2
Channel # 1. Conversely, this bit-field will set to â1â
anytime there has been a change in the âLoop-back
Request Statusâ for DS2 Channel # 1.
NOTE: This bit-field will be asserted in response to either of
the following conditions.
1. The âLoop-back Request Statusâ for DS2 Chan-
nel 1 has transitioned from the active to the inac-
tive state.
2. The Loop-back Request Statusâ for DS2 Channel
1 has transition from the inactive to the active
state.

Bit 6 - Loop-back Request Status - M23 # 7
This âRead-Onlyâ bit-field reflect the current Loop-
back Request state of M23 # 7.
This bit-field will be set to â1â if the âLoop-back Re-
questâ for M23 # 7 is currently active.
Conversely, this bit-field will be set to â0â if the âLoop-
back Requestâ for M23 # 7 is currently inactive.
Bit 5 - Loop-back Request Status - M23 # 6
This âRead-Onlyâ bit-field reflect the current Loop-
back Request state of M23 # 6.
This bit-field will be set to â1â if the âLoop-back Re-
questâ for M23 # 6 is currently active.
Conversely, this bit-field will be set to â0â if the âLoop-
back Requestâ for M23 # 6 is currently inactive.
Bit 4 - Loop-back Request Status - M23 # 5
This âRead-Onlyâ bit-field reflect the current Loop-
back Request state of M23 # 5.
This bit-field will be set to â1â if the âLoop-back Re-
questâ for M23 # 5 is currently active.
Conversely, this bit-field will be set to â0â if the âLoop-
back Requestâ for M23 # 5 is currently inactive.
Bit 3 - Loop-back Request Status - M23 # 4
This âRead-Onlyâ bit-field reflect the current Loop-
back Request state of M23 # 4.
This bit-field will be set to â1â if the âLoop-back Re-
questâ for M23 # 4 is currently active.
Conversely, this bit-field will be set to â0â if the âLoop-
back Requestâ for M23 # 4 is currently inactive.
Bit 2 - Loop-back Request Status - M23 # 3
This âRead-Onlyâ bit-field reflect the current Loop-
back Request state of M23 # 3.
This bit-field will be set to â1â if the âLoop-back Re-
questâ for M23 # 3 is currently active.
Conversely, this bit-field will be set to â0â if the âLoop-
back Requestâ for M23 # 3 is currently inactive.
Bit 1 - Loop-back Request Status - M23 # 2
This âRead-Onlyâ bit-field reflect the current Loop-
back Request state of M23 # 2.
This bit-field will be set to â1â if the âLoop-back Re-
questâ for M23 # 2 is currently active.
Conversely, this bit-field will be set to â0â if the âLoop-
back Requestâ for M23 # 2 is currently inactive.
Bit 0 - Loop-back Request Status - M23 # 1
This âRead-Onlyâ bit-field reflect the current Loop-
back Request state of M23 # 1.
This bit-field will be set to â1â if the âLoop-back Re-
questâ for M23 # 1 is currently active.
Conversely, this bit-field will be set to â0â if the âLoop-
back Requestâ for M23 # 1 is currently inactive.
